Surety Bonds Are Insurance Coverage



Guaranty bonds aren't insurance policies. This is a common mistaken belief that many people have. It's important to comprehend the difference in between the two.

Insurance plan are designed to shield the insured event from potential future losses. They give protection for a wide range of dangers, consisting of residential or commercial property damage, liability, and personal injury.

On the other hand, guaranty bonds are a type of assurance that guarantees a certain commitment will be met. They're commonly made use of in building jobs to make certain that service providers complete their job as set. The surety bond supplies economic security to the task proprietor in case the contractor falls short to meet their obligations.

Surety Bonds Are Only for Construction Jobs



Currently let's change our emphasis to the misconception that surety bonds are exclusively made use of in building and construction jobs. While it holds true that guaranty bonds are frequently related to the building and construction market, they aren't limited to it.

Surety bonds are actually utilized in numerous sectors and markets to ensure that contractual responsibilities are fulfilled. Guaranty Bonds Are Costly and Cost-Prohibitive



Don't allow the mistaken belief fool you - surety bonds don't need to break the bank or be cost-prohibitive. Unlike popular belief, surety bonds can in fact be a cost-efficient remedy for your company. Here are 3 reasons that guaranty bonds aren't as pricey as you might assume:

1. ** Competitive Rates **: Surety bond premiums are based on a percent of the bond quantity. With a vast array of surety providers out there, you can search for the very best prices and locate a bond that fits your budget.

2. ** Financial Advantages **: Guaranty bonds can in fact save you cash in the future. By supplying an economic warranty to your clients, you can protect a lot more agreements and raise your company chances, ultimately bring about greater earnings.

3. ** Flexibility **: Surety bond needs can be tailored to satisfy your certain requirements. Whether you need a small bond for a single task or a larger bond for recurring job, there are options offered to fit your budget plan and company demands.
